[PATCH v4 1/3] ceph: fix use-after-free in check_new_map() after early session put

check_new_map() drops mdsc->mutex while it locks a session, prepares a
reconnect, or kicks flushing caps. A concurrent teardown can call
__unregister_session() in that window and drop the sessions[]
reference. When check_new_map() reacquires mdsc->mutex, its temporary
reference may therefore be the only reference keeping the local
variable `s` alive.
Commit ee611a750955 ("ceph: fix UAF in check_new_map() on session freed
during unlock") addressed this by taking a temporary reference around
each unlock window, but it drops that reference as soon as mdsc->mutex
is reacquired, while `s` is still in use:
ceph_get_mds_session(s);
mutex_unlock(&mdsc->mutex);
mutex_lock(&s->s_mutex);
mutex_lock(&mdsc->mutex);
ceph_put_mds_session(s); /* may drop the last reference */
ceph_con_close(&s->s_con); /* use-after-free */
mutex_unlock(&s->s_mutex); /* use-after-free */
s->s_state = CEPH_MDS_SESSION_RESTARTING;
If the session was unregistered during the window, the sessions[]
reference is already gone, so this ceph_put_mds_session() frees it.
Additionally, the session could be freed while its s_mutex is locked,
which trips the WARN_ON(mutex_is_locked(&s->s_mutex)) in
ceph_put_mds_session() and then unlocks freed memory.
Fix this by holding a single reference for the whole loop iteration:
look the session up with __ceph_lookup_mds_session(), which returns it
with a reference held, and release that reference on every exit from
the loop body. This subsumes the per-window get/put pairs, so remove
them.
